WebbThe rhyolite is composed of 45–50% K-feldspar, 25–30% quartz, 10–15% albite plagioclase, 3–7% biotite, and 1–3% opaque oxides (by volume). WebbThe Round Top Mountain peraluminous rhyolite, exposed at the surface in Sierra Blanca, Hudspeth County, west Texas, USA, is enriched in yttrium and heavy rare earth elements (YHREEs). Other potentially valuable elements in the deposit include Be, Li, U, Th, Sn, F, Nb, and Ta.
